    I am using Win 7 Ultimate.
    So I am trying to play a DVD with DTS 5.1 Audio.
    I am not getting sound! What shall I do?

    Try installing ac3filter and see if it helps - I think it is supposed to handle dts despite the name. - and ffdshow might be worth looking into as well.


    Also I do think there are audio packs you can buy seperately for windows media player to handle non dolby sound.

    Or try playing it with vlc or mediaplayerclassic. Those are both free to use.
